Is astral projection real? This question often sparks curiosity and debate among those interested in the mysteries of the mind and the universe. Astral projection, sometimes referred to as an out-of-body experience (OBE), is a phenomenon where a person feels as if they are floating outside their physical body. While some view it as a spiritual journey, others seek scientific explanations. Let’s explore the different perspectives around this intriguing topic.

Is Astral Projection Real

For many, astral projection is a captivating concept. Believers often describe it as a spiritual experience that allows the soul to travel beyond the physical realm. They recount vivid experiences of floating above their bodies, visiting distant places, or even exploring other dimensions. These accounts are often rich and detailed, leading some to accept them as genuine.

However, skeptics argue that these experiences could be the result of vivid dreams or hallucinations. Without concrete evidence, they maintain a cautious stance. Despite the lack of scientific validation, the belief in astral projection persists, fueled by personal testimonies and cultural stories passed down through generations.

Astral Projection Proof

When it comes to proving astral projection, the evidence is largely anecdotal. Many people share personal stories of their experiences, often with striking similarities. These narratives provide a sense of validation for believers, but they fall short of scientific proof.

Some experiments have attempted to test the validity of astral projection by having participants describe objects or events they couldn’t have seen from their physical location. The results have been mixed, with no definitive proof emerging. The challenge lies in replicating these experiences under controlled conditions, which remains an elusive goal for researchers.

Science of OBEs

The scientific community approaches out-of-body experiences with curiosity and skepticism. Researchers explore OBEs through the lens of neurology and psychology, seeking to understand what happens in the brain during these events. Some studies suggest that OBEs may occur when certain areas of the brain are disrupted, leading to a sensation of detachment from the body.

Neuroscientists have identified the temporoparietal junction as a key area involved in body perception. When this region is stimulated or disrupted, people may experience sensations similar to astral projection. This scientific perspective provides a possible explanation grounded in brain activity rather than spiritual phenomena.
